Visit Grand Junction Press Results

Visit Grand Junction's PR Highlights as a result of pitching:

Wherever Family highlighted Grand Junction in an online article titled "How To Have The Ultimate Summer Adventure in Grand Junction, Colorado" on March 21, 2023. The article mentioned James M. Robb-Colorado River State Park, Highline Lake State Park, Las Colonias Park, Colorado National Monument, Rattlesnake Canyon, McInnis Canyons National Conservation Area, Lunch Loops, Kokopelli Loops, and Little Book Cliffs Wild Horse Reserve. Grand Junction area businesses and events that were also mentioned include Rimrock Adventures, Jet Boat Colorado, Grand Junction Adventures, Adrenaline Driven Adventure Company, Camp Eddy, Country Jam Colorado, and Colorado Lavender Festival. 

Prime Women mentioned Grand Junction in an online article titled "Top 12 Yoga Retreats for Mature Women" on March 29, 2023. The article highlighted Grand Junction Adventures' Women's Adventure & Wellness Yoga Retreat in Ruby Horsethief Canyon. 

Men's Journal listed Grand Junction in an article titled "7 Wild New Mountain Bike Trails and Destinations" on April 6, 2023. The article featured Lunch Loops, the Tabeguache Trail, Kokopelli Loops Trail Area, Colorado River, Palisade Plunge, Boneshaker Adventures, and Handlebar Tap House.
